Martín Aarón Ponce Camacho (born June 30, 1992) is a Mexican former professional footballer who last played as a midfielder for Real Zamora.
Career
On March 12, 2013, Ponce made his professional debut with Chivas USA against the Portland Timbers in a 3–0 loss. He came on as a substitute for Marvin Iraheta in the 59th minute.[1]
